I watched all of Impact last night (first time ever, by the way... since the Spike TV debut) with the intention of just watching.  Giving them a real chance, for a change.  What I saw last night wasn't bad by any stretch (James Gang excluded) but really, it left me with nothing to look forward to.  They spent way too much time on Joe/Angle 3, and nearly squashing their fucking champ in a curtain jerker.  Besides AMW breaking up, I don't recall anything else happening.  Hell, they had 3 matches that occured; Petey Williams vs Christopher Daniels, AMW vs LAX and Abyss vs Killings.  I know they only have 1 hour, but come on, with only 3 shows between PPVs, you'd think something could be different.  I mean, it's a bit better than a show full of 2-minute squashes, as it was when they were on Fox Sports but not by too much.

I think my biggest complaint is a simple one: It's not symetrical. 4-sides means the wrestlers NEVER have to think "Ok, am I  near one of the two 90-degree corners or one of the four 45s??" or "Is this the long side of the ring, or the short?". Just run and go.

UFC's Octagon works too, because it's ALSO symetrical. No matter where anyone is in the octagon, all 8 sides/corners are identical.
